标签: xmpp openfire ejabberd strophe
如何使用Strophe lib为JS获取我的“朋友”的在线状态?不是名单,即使是单一的存在(或者我要在名册中做1个req / user?) 通常我只会在每个资源的“状态变化”时收到通知,但我想知道用户是在线还是离线(如Pidgin),而不考虑每个用户可以同时在线记录的许多资源。
答案 0 :(得分:5)
默认情况下将所有用户视为离线。对于所有在线用户资源,您将自动获得状态通知。 您可以获得所有状态更改,并在登录后获得所有在线联系人的初始状态。